What Is the Cost of Living Near Syracuse?

Understanding the cost of living near Syracuse is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Cortland Ag.
Syracuse's Cost of Living Index is approximately 80.7 (19.3% less expensive than US average; 35.5% less than NY average). Central NY city (Syracuse Univ.), affordable housing, snow. Centro b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Cortland Ag,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$900 - $1,400+ A significant portion of Cortland Ag sal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$170 - $280 (Heating significant)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$60 (Centro mon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$380 - $560 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$690+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,210 - $3,560+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
